What's This "Gamification" Thing?

Think about your favorite games. They usually have things like points you can earn, levels you can reach, special stickers or badges you can collect, and maybe even a scoreboard to see how you're doing compared to others.

"Gamification" is just using those fun game ideas in things that aren't actually games.

Like on Duolingo, you get a "streak" for learning every day – that feels like a little challenge! Or on some shopping apps, you can earn coins to get discounts – that's like a reward in a game!

 

Why Does This Game Stuff Actually Work?

Let's see why making things feel like a game can be so helpful:

  • It Makes Your Brain Happy! When you finish a little task or get a badge, your brain gets a little happy boost. It makes you want to do it again!
  • It Helps You Keep Going: Think about a video game with a progress bar that fills up as you get closer to finishing a level. It makes you want to keep playing until it's full! Gamification does the same thing with other tasks.
  • It Makes You Feel Like It's Yours: When you get to create a little character or earn special things online, you feel more connected to it. It becomes your thing, and you want to stick with it.
  • It Can Be a Fun Way to Compete : Sometimes, seeing how you're doing compared to others on a scoreboard can push you to try a little harder – in a fun way!
  • It Makes Learning Easier: If you're learning something new through an app that feels like a game, it's much more interesting than just reading words on a screen. You're actually doing things and discovering new stuff.

 

Where Can We Use These Game Ideas?

You might be surprised where gamification can pop up:

  • Learning Apps: Turning lessons into fun quests and challenges.
  • Fitness Trackers: Giving you rewards for reaching your step goals or completing workouts.
  • Shopping Websites: Letting you earn points for purchases and unlock special discounts.
  • Work Tools: Making training or teamwork more engaging with points and leaderboards.
  • Loyalty Programs: Making it more exciting to be a loyal customer with fun rewards.
